The French Gazelle packages are all done.

What really helped, was the discovery of some great scenery of 4 French bases, that can be used in conjunction with the FSX/P3D package helicopter overlays. The sceneries are available as free-ware downloads at fafzone.fr and Occitania Aeroports Regionaux. They can be used as is with my Gazelles, after removing a few static helicopter files:

FS9 was a bit more of a challenge and I thought at one stage there was not much I could provide scenery-wise. However, I was so grateful to see John Tenn riding to the rescue with the donation of some AFCAD and terrain files for the same 4 French bases used in FSX/P3D. What I then did is raid the ABO and Euromil object libraries to add some 3-D detail, though I did have to make the passenger terminal at PAU (LFBP):

Image

The two packages, FS9 and FSX/P3D, were uploaded this morning. As always, please allow time for them to be processed and made available.

Is the flight plan for the Puma's using the same ICAO codes as the overlays, or the underlying AFCAD?

PS: sorry, should have said,

There is generally only enough parking in the overlays for the Gazelles. Pumas and Tigers park in a different location on the airfields to the Gazelles, so these will need separate overlays with unique ICAO codes.

I had some issues setting up Pau in P3D v4.5, your side of things seems perfect, but 2 bgl files within the package from http://occitania.gratisim.fr. cause problems. The 2 files in question are/were LFBP_ADEX_MOUSS_GP.bgl (Contains all the ground markings for the airport) and CVX_lfbp.bgl(terrain, flattens and exclusions). With these 2 files installed I was getting a ctd. Remove them and the airport loads fine, obviously without said features.I converted the cvx file with Terrain Sculptor Pro, the GP file with ModelConverter X and the required bmp files - converted to dxt1 with alpha. All appears to be close to as it should be, I just have some flickering ground textures on the civilian side and a small chunk of taxiway missing. I tried resetting draw flags for taxiway and aprons, to no avail. Do you have any pointers to get me in the right direction for finishing the conversion off?
